Key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Contribute to the development and review of HACCP and Quality Management systems and other codes of practice to ensure compliance and safety.

  • Monitoring and implementation of the Quality Assurance Procedures.

  • Assist with quality control function including incoming inspections, process controls, scheduled quality checks.

  • Carry out routine sampling i.e. sampling of raw materials and finished product, swab the plant to assess hygiene levels.

  • Keeping sampling records and results updated and reporting of the results.

  • Monitor internal Quality Control analysis results and taking corrective and preventive action where results fall outside target specifications.

  • Lead quality initiatives e.g. providing technical support, process improvements.

  • Assist with the investigation of quality issues & taking prompt action to resolve issues, demonstrating effective communication when dealing with customer complaints and quality issues.

  • Recording all non-conformances and returned products along with carrying out investigation, and report findings.

  • Respond to customer queries or complaints in a timely and efficient manner through case management.

  • Trace, investigate, sample and test to find potential root cause of customer complaints or queries.

  • Dispensary operations to include weighments; stock management; reconciliation of additives & medications; validation checks on customer prescriptions, QC approval of materials onto site.

  • Verification, and validation of product re-work streams.

  • Management of test equipment performance via routine maintenance and calibration checks.

  • Carry out internal audits and report findings.

  • Report anomalies in processes, product, or procedures.

  • Update the quality manual and working instructions as necessary.

  • Carry out Quality Induction Training for new employees and maintain training records.

  • Responsible for the day-to-day quality function & assisting in the running of the department.

  • Comply with all health, safety, and environmental regulations.

  • Maintain confidentiality and adhere to company policies.
